Saudi Arabia’s precautionary decision to suspend attendance to workplaces amid COVID-19 has not impacted business continuity due to the existence of digital infrastructure, systems, and platforms, the Ministry of Finance has said. 

The Chairman of the Steering Committee of the Ministry of Finance Abdulaziz Al-Freih said that digital transformation adopted by the various sectors have ensured business continuity.

The educational, health, justice, security, civil, and financial sectors took the lead in onboarding the necessary digital infrastructure. 

Saudi Arabia is ranked third in the world for the largest fifth-generation networks in 2019 and came third in technical governance among G-20 countries.
